Gathering together to honor the year's best in cinema, the 69th Annual Golden Globe Awards winners have officially been named.

With the event taking place at the Beverly Hilton Hotel on Sunday evening (January 15), Ricky Gervais tended to hosting duties while "The Descendants" was named as Best Drama Motion Picture and "The Artist" ended up taking home the top prize of Best Comedy or Musical Motion Picture.

Other big winners at the Golden Globe Awards were George Clooney, who was named as Best Actor for his effort in "The Descendants" while Meryl Streep was doted with Best Actress honors for her portrayal of Margaret Thatcher in "The Iron Lady".

Meanwhile, television's top accolades went to "Modern Family" as Best Comedy TV Series and "Homeland" as Best Drama TV Series.

With exclusive pictures from the show found below, the complete list of 69th Annual Golden Globe winners are:

Best Motion Picture Drama

WINNER: The Descendants (2011)

The Help (2011)

Hugo (2011)

The Ides of March (2011)

Moneyball (2011)

War Horse (2011)

Best Motion Picture Comedy or Musical

50/50 (2011)

WINNER: The Artist (2011)

Bridesmaids (2011)

Midnight in Paris (2011)

My Week With Marilyn (2011)

Best Actor in a Motion Picture Drama

WINNER: George Clooney, The Descendants (2011)

Leonardo DiCaprio, J. Edgar (2011)

Michael Fassbender, Shame (2011)

Ryan Gosling, The Ides of March (2011)

Brad Pitt, Moneyball (2011)

Best Actor in a Motion Picture Comedy Musical

WINNER: Jean Dujardin, The Artist (2011)

Brendan Gleeson, The Guard (2011)

Joseph Gordon Levitt, 50/50 (2011)

Ryan Gosling, Crazy Stupid Love (2011)

Owen Wilson, Midnight in Paris (2011)

Best Actor in a Supporting Role Motion Picture

Kenneth Branagh, My Week With Marilyn (2011)

Albert Brooks, Drive (2011)

Jonah Hill, Moneyball (2011)

Viggo Mortensen, A Dangerous Method (2011)

WINNER: Christopher Plummer, Beginners (2011)

Best Actress in a Supporting Role Motion Picture

Berenice Bejo, The Artist (2011)

Jessica Chastain, The Help (2011)

Janet McTeer, Albert Nobbs (2011)

WINNER: Octavia Spencer, The Help (2011)

Shailene Woodley, The Descendants (2011)

Best TV Series Drama

American Horror Story

Boardwalk Empire

Boss

Game of Thrones

WINNER: Homeland

Best Actor in a Miniseries or TV Movie

Hugh Bonnevile, Downton Abbey

WINNER: Idris Elba, Luther

William Hurt, Too Big to Fail

Bill Nighy, Page Eight

Dominic West, The Hour

Best Actor in a TV Series Drama

Steve Buscemi, Boardwalk Empire

Bryan Cranston, Breaking Bad

WINNER: Kelsey Grammer, Boss

Jeremy Irons, The Borgias

Damian Lewis, Homeland

Best Actress in a Miniseries or TV Movie

Romola Garai, The Hour

Diane Lane, Cinema Verite

Elizabeth McGovern, Downtown Abbey

Emily Watson, Appropriate Adult

WINNER: Kate Winslet, Mildred Pierce

Best Director Motion Picture

Woody Allen, Midnight in Paris (2011)

George Clooney, The Ides of March (2011)

Michel Hazanavicius, The Artist (2011)

Alexander Payne, The Descendants (2011)

WINNER: Martin Scorsese, Hugo (2011)

Best Actress in a Motion Picture Drama

Glenn Close, Albert Nobbs (2011)

Viola Davis, The Help (2011)

Rooney Mara, The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o (2011)

WINNER: Meryl Streep, The Iron Lady (2011)

Tilda Swinton, We Need to Talk About Kevin (2011)

Best Actress in a Motion Picture Musical/Comedy

Jodie Foster, Carnage (2011)

Charlize Theron, Young Adult (2011)

Kristen Wiig, Bridesmaids (2011)

WINNER: Michelle Williams, My Week With Marilyn (2011)

Kate Winslet, Carnage (2011)

Best Screenplay Motion Picture

WINNER: Midnight in Paris (2011)

The Ides of March (2011)

The Artist (2011)

The Descendants (2011)

Moneyball (2011)

Best Animated Feature Film

WINNER: The Adventures of Tin-Tin (2011)

Arthur Christmas (2011)

Cars 2 (2011)

Puss N Boots (2011)

Rango (2011)

Best Original Song Motion Picture

WINNER: Masterpiece W.E.

Music & Lyrics by: Madonna, Julie Frost, Jimmy Harry

Hello Hello Gnomeo & Juliet

Music by: Elton John

Lyrics by: Bernie Taupin

The Keeper Machine Gun Preacher

Music & Lyrics by: Chris Cornell

"Lay Your Head Down Albert Nobbs

Music by: Brian Byrne

Lyrics by: Glenn Close

The Living Proof The Help

Music by: Mary J. Blige, Thomas Newman, Harvey Mason Jr.

Lyrics by: Mary J. Blige, Harvey Mason Jr., Damon Thomas

Best Original Score Motion Picture

WINNER: The Artist (2011)

W.E. (2011)

The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o (2011)

Hugo (2011)

War Horse (2011)

Best Foreign Language Film

Flowers of War (2011)

In the Land of Blood and Honey (2011)

The Kid With the Bike (2011)

The Skin I Live In (2011)

WINNER: A Separation (2011)

Best TV Series Comedy

Enlightened

Episodes

Glee

WINNER: Modern Family

New Girl

Best Actor in a TV Comedy Series

Alec Baldwin, 30 Rock

David Duchovny, Californication

Johnny Galecki, The Big Bang Theory

Thomas Jane, Hung

WINNER: Matt LeBlanc, Episodes

Best Actress in a TV Series Comedy or Musical

WINNER: Laura Dern, Enlightened

Zooey Deschanel, New Girl

Tina Fey, 30 Rock

Laura Linney, The Big C

Amy Poehler, Parks and Recreation

Best Actress in a TV Drama Series

WINNER: Claire Danes, Homeland

Mireille Enos, The Killing

Julianna Margulies, The Good Wife

Madeline Stowe, Revenge

Callie Thorne, Necessary Roughness

Best Supporting Actor in a Series, Miniseries or TV Movie

WINNER: Peter Dinklage, Game of Thrones (2011)

Paul Giamatti, Too Big to Fail (2011)

Guy Pearce, Mildred Pierce (2011)

Tim Robbins, Cinema Verite (2011)

Eric Stonestreet, Modern Family (2011)

Best Supporting Actress in a Series, Miniseries or TV Movie

WINNER: Jessica Lange, American Horror Story

Kelly MacDonald, Game of Thrones

Maggie Smith, Downton Abbey

Sofia Vergara, Modern Family

Evan Rachel Wood, Mildred Pierce

Best TV Movie or Miniseries

Cinema Verite

WINNER: Downton Abbey

The Hour

Mildred Pierce

Too Big to Fail
